Exocraft Accelration Module blueprint; didn't get it
Currently doing the Exocraft Terminal missions, I'm on the one which asks you to get to a beacon before time runs out. The specialist recommends that you use the Acceleration Module to get there faster.

Only problem is, I can't build it. A quick Google reveals that I was supposed to have received it from the previous mission but I never did. It's not already installed on the Exocraft either, I made sure of that.

Is there another way to get it, reset the missions or am I out of luck?

Check your mission logs again, maybe something didn't get finished yet.

I guess one thing to try is to dismantle the Exocraft station and place it back again, maybe in a different room (the NPC there is fine in the void in the mean time). That might refresh things and back things up to where you need to be at.

Worst comes to worst, if the bug is persistent, you can use the save file editor. A main function of it is to fix such glitches in a timely manner. You can delete the editor program afterwards if the temptation to cheat seems too strong.
(does require Java)
